Developing the Whole Child
We create opportunities beyond academics through sports, arts, performance, martial arts, and creative engagement, helping children build confidence, discipline, teamwork, and social skills.
Co-curricular activities are not extras; they are essential to holistic development. For children from underserved communities, these programs often provide the only structured opportunity for creative expression, physical activity, and joyful play.
What We Offer
Sports & Games
Football, cricket, athletics, and team sports that build physical health, discipline, and teamwork.
Arts & Crafts
Drawing, painting, collage, and visual arts that nurture creativity and expression.
Performing Arts
Dance, theatre, music, and storytelling that develop communication skills and cultural pride.
Martial Arts
Karate and self-defence training that builds discipline, focus, confidence, and physical fitness.
